Understanding RAM: What You Need to Know

Before delving into how to select RAM, it’s essential to understand what RAM is and how it functions within your laptop.

What is RAM?

RAM is a type of computer memory that temporarily stores data for applications in use, enabling faster access to this information compared to reading from a hard drive. The more RAM your laptop has, the more data it can handle simultaneously.

Types of RAM

There are several types of RAM used in laptops, with the most common being:

  • DDR (Double Data Rate): DDR comes in various generations, with DDR3 and DDR4 being prevalent in current laptops. DDR5 is beginning to emerge but may not be widely available yet.
  • SO-DIMM (Small Outline Dual In-line Memory Module): SO-DIMMs are smaller than standard DIMMs and are used in laptops because of their compact size.

Determining Your Laptop’s RAM Requirements

Selecting the right RAM begins with understanding your usage needs.

Assessing Usage Scenarios

Different users have different RAM needs:

  • Casual Users: If you primarily browse the web and use standard applications like word processors, 8GB of RAM is usually sufficient.
  • Business Professionals or Students: For using applications like spreadsheets, presentations, or running multiple tabs, 16GB is a more suitable option.
  • Gamers and Content Creators: For gaming or editing videos, investing in 32GB or more is advisable for optimal performance.

Operating System Considerations

The operating system you are using also plays a role in how much RAM you need:

  • Windows: Windows 10 and Windows 11 generally benefit from at least 8GB of RAM for standard tasks and 16GB or more for demanding applications.
  • macOS: Recent versions of macOS perform well with 8GB, but most users find that 16GB or more offers a better experience, especially for professional software.

Compatibility: Ensuring the Right Fit

Not all RAM is created equal; ensuring compatibility with your laptop is crucial for a successful upgrade.

Checking Your Laptop’s Specifications

The first step in selecting RAM is to check your laptop’s specifications. You can do this by:

  • Consulting the User Manual: The user manual usually contains the specifications and upgradable components of the laptop.
  • Manufacturer’s Website: Visit the company’s website for detailed specifications of your model.
  • Using RAM Check Tools: Applications like CPU-Z can provide detailed information on the current RAM your laptop uses and what is supported.

Key Specifications to Consider

When looking at RAM, pay attention to the following specifications:

  • Type of RAM: Verify if your laptop uses DDR3, DDR4, or DDR5.
  • Form Factor: Most laptops use SO-DIMM, while desktops use DIMM. Ensure you get the right form factor.
  • Frequency: Measured in MHz, the frequency indicates how fast the RAM can operate. Higher frequencies generally offer better performance. Match the frequency with what is supported by your motherboard.

Installing Your RAM: A Step-by-Step Guide

After selecting the right RAM, the next step is installation. Here’s a simple guide to help you through the process.

What You’ll Need

  • Screwdriver
  • Anti-static wrist strap (optional but recommended)
  • Your new RAM sticks

Installation Steps

  1. Power Off Your Laptop: Shut down the laptop and disconnect it from the power source. Remove the battery if possible.
  2. Open the Laptop: Use a screwdriver to open the access panel—this can usually be found on the underside.
  3. Locate Existing RAM: Identify the current RAM slots.
  4. Remove Old RAM (if necessary): If you’re replacing RAM, gently release the clips on either side of the RAM module to remove it.
  5. Install New RAM: Align the notch in the RAM with the slot, angle the RAM slightly, and press down until it clicks into place.
  6. Reassemble Your Laptop: Close the access panel and reconnect the battery and power.
  7. Boot Up: Start your laptop and check if the system recognizes the new RAM by going into the system settings.

Troubleshooting Common Issues

After installation, you might encounter issues such as:

RAM Not Recognized

  • Ensure the RAM is properly seated in the slot.
  • Confirm compatibility with the motherboard and laptop.

Blue Screen of Death (BSOD) or System Crashes

  • Remove and reseat the RAM modules.
  • Run a RAM diagnostic test to analyze issues.

Can I upgrade the RAM in my laptop?

Whether you can upgrade your laptop’s RAM depends on its design and specifications. Many laptops come with upgradable RAM slots, allowing you to enhance your system’s memory. To determine if your laptop can be upgraded, consult the manufacturer’s documentation or specifications and check for user-accessible panels for RAM installation.

Keep in mind that some laptops, especially those with soldered RAM, do not allow for upgrades. In such cases, you’ll need to choose a model with adequate RAM based on your computing needs at the time of purchase. Always verify compatibility with your laptop’s existing components before proceeding with any upgrades.

What is the difference between single-channel and dual-channel RAM?

Single-channel and dual-channel configurations refer to how RAM modules communicate with the CPU. In a single-channel setup, a single memory module is utilized, which can limit performance as data transfer speeds are restricted. However, in a dual-channel configuration, two RAM modules work together, effectively doubling the data channels and resulting in faster data access and improved performance.

For optimal performance, especially in memory-intensive applications or gaming, it’s advisable to use a dual-channel setup. This typically means installing two identical RAM modules simultaneously, which maximizes bandwidth and enhances your laptop’s overall speed and efficiency.

How do I know if my RAM is compatible with my laptop?

To ensure RAM compatibility, you need to consider factors such as the RAM type (DDR4, DDR5), form factor (SO-DIMM for most laptops), and the maximum capacity supported by your laptop. Checking your laptop’s user manual or the manufacturer’s website can provide specific details about supported RAM specifications.

Tools like CPU-Z or Crucial’s System Scanner can also help identify your current RAM and its specifications, assisting you in choosing replacement or upgrade RAM that matches. Always confirm that the RAM you select meets your laptop’s requirements to avoid installation difficulties or performance issues.
